Understanding Zinc Gluconate

Zinc gluconate is a zinc salt of gluconic acid and is commonly used to treat zinc deficiency. Zinc plays a crucial role in numerous bodily functions, including immune response, protein synthesis, wound healing, and DNA synthesis. By supplementing with zinc gluconate, you can help ensure your body has sufficient levels of this essential mineral.

The Best Time to Take Zinc Gluconate

1. With Food or Without Food?

One of the most common questions is whether to take zinc gluconate with food or on an empty stomach. While taking zinc on an empty stomach can enhance absorption, it may also lead to gastrointestinal discomfort for some individuals. Therefore, the best time to take zinc gluconate is typically with a meal. This can help mitigate any potential stomach upset while still allowing for adequate absorption.

Additional Tips for Taking Zinc Gluconate

– Avoid Excessive Calcium and Iron: High doses of calcium and iron can interfere with zinc absorption. If you’re taking these supplements, try to space them out by a few hours.
– Stay Hydrated: Drink plenty of water when taking supplements to help with absorption and reduce the risk of digestive discomfort.
